Haiti President Preval Asks UN To Switch MINUSTAH To BUILD-U-STAH!

In Haiti, we need bulldozers and engineers, not tanks, and soldiers - At the United Nations yesterday, outgoing Haitian president Rene Preval said that there has been a military presence for 11 years in a country with no war [HAITI].

MINUSTAH Should Be Transformed To BUILD-U-STAH...

"Tanks, armored vehicles and soldiers should have given way to bulldozers, engineers, more police instructors, experts in support to justice and to the penitentiary system," President Preval says

Haiti is not at war, Haiti is a country is under construction!

"Peacekeeping operations did not quickly enough adapt to the new situation," President Preval says

Haiti's problem is under-development, the president said according to AFP
